Mr. Diarmuid Collins:

The IMI was involved in executive education, that is, education for people already in the workplace, primarily executive programmes. We did not have that offering as part of our business school. It is a gap in what we provide. We are obliged under the Universities Act to retrain and reskill and deliver lifelong learning, and in the area of business we did not have that offering. The IMI now allows us to make that offering.

It delivers programmes for multinationals, Irish and overseas companies and small businesses on developing leadership, management and provides executive education in Ireland and abroad.
